This is actually a really great application for LLMs. Most people who
get stuck with Linux system administration, packaging etc. get stuck
because they don't even know what question to ask. LLMs are very good at
taking vague requirements and finding particular jargon and technical
approaches that match them.

> I don't have a lot of faith in AI for anything that requires truth or
> accuracy. "AI" (LLMs) are just probablity graphs of what words are most
> likely to follow other words. As such, they don't have a knowledge of
> things as they are (really, don't have knowledge, per se).
>
> There is a reason why some online tech answer platforms have banned the use
> of, say, chatGPT-generated answers (including, for example, GPT claiming
> that API calls have parameters that don't actually exist).
>
> There is a reason why judges are getting really put out with attorneys who
> submit case documents generated by GPT (for example, GPT creating
> non-existant case names out of thin air, and then citing them).
>
> There is at least one case of a LLM AI telling a user that the world would
> be better off without him and that he should self-delete.
>
> You might get lucky ... but it's better to actually know what you're doing
> and why you're doing it.
